Who funds Bjc Home Care Services

EIN 43-1450457 · Saint Louis, MO · NTEE P75Z

Bjc Home Care Services of Saint Louis, MO (EIN 43-1450457) was named as a grant recipient by 8 funders in 15 grants paid totaling $8,340,216 in tax years 2018–2024, as reported on the funders' Forms 990-PF and 990 Schedule I.
